  • Summary: The jazz trio introduces vocals by Wendy Lewis on its latest album of cover songs.

For All I Care, the trio's first all-covers album, underscores their capacity for democratizing yet again, but the fitful ease of amalgamating Ligeti's stark neoclassicism ('Fem (Etude No. 8)') with Heart's goofy lilt ('Barracuda') sounds too harmless, with or without a powerful singer.
